Output 29efaabacd943f2b0489fa7ab6848d1d4dd2663ced210c1525dee0fc19847ff1:0

value
18128707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1f1b63209abedc66bd4f11456c773e4d68703e8 OP_EQUALVERIFY OP_CHECKSIG
address
1HDtANtZfJpwNfrADXkeam4USB8u4mkZW3
transaction
29efaabacd943f2b0489fa7ab6848d1d4dd2663ced210c1525dee0fc19847ff1
spent
true